Transaction 596c97229e49467002cd176ce5c1ce7fa7406b3cfeb277f7564fef71bd71cd1f

1 Input
2 Outputs
  • 596c97229e49467002cd176ce5c1ce7fa7406b3cfeb277f7564fef71bd71cd1f:0
  • value  135760
    address  1M15EceUr1HbAvp3Szp9aAgp4ycFL9YS36
  • 596c97229e49467002cd176ce5c1ce7fa7406b3cfeb277f7564fef71bd71cd1f:1
  • value  3911062
    address  1L3gsabsHrG5x9vTbacsbHt8kWULdunXx8